Q. Input offset voltage of operational amplifier?
When both inputs are tied to ground, i.e., both differential-mode and common-mode inputs are zero, the output should be zero. In practice there will be mismatches in amplifier components, and if there is a mismatch in an input stage, the effect will be amplified, leading to a significant output voltage. The input offset voltage VOS is the differential input voltage required to make the output zero, and is typically 1 mV. With some op amps, e.g., the 741, two voltage offset terminals are provided, and by connecting a potentiometer between them and taking the slider to the specified dc supply rail (or bus), as in Figure, the potentiometer can then be adjusted to zero the offset voltage.
